Essential Responsive Web Design Optimal Guidelines
To ensure a fantastic user journey across a diverse range of platforms, implementing responsive web construction top practices is absolutely critical. Firstly, use a flexible grid system – consider utilizing frameworks like Bootstrap or Foundation to simplify this process. Secondly, prioritize images optimization; they often represent a significant portion of a page’s load time. Implement methods such as adaptive images and lazy loading. Do not neglecting touch targets, especially for mobile users – ensure buttons and links are adequately sized and spaced. Periodically test your design on various platforms, from oversized desktops to small smartphones. Finally, pay close focus to typography; font sizes and line heights should be scalable to maintain readability across different viewports. By adhering to these methods, you can create a user-friendly web presence for everyone.

Boosting Website Conversions Through Smart Design
A optimized website isn't just about aesthetics; it's a powerful tool for securing conversions. To truly maximize your return on investment, focus on creating a user-friendly experience that guides visitors toward desired actions. This involves carefully considering elements like streamlined navigation, clear calls to action placed above the fold, and a logical layout. Employing visual hierarchy to highlight important check here information and minimizing distractions is crucial. Furthermore, ensure your site is thoroughly responsive, adapting seamlessly to all platform sizes. Speed is also paramount; slow loading times can significantly impact bounce rates and ultimately, your conversion success. Regular A/B testing of different design choices can help pinpoint what resonates best with your target audience and leads to enhanced conversion performance. Finally, consider incorporating trust signals, like testimonials and security badges, to build confidence and encourage visitors to take the desired action.
